Valley Park Community School
Norton Avenue, Sheffield S14 1SL
https://www.valleypark.sheffield.sch.uk/
School indicators
Staff indicators
Valley Park Community School is an
academy
. It has about 440 boys and girls aged between 3 and 11. In March 2018 the school was rated
‘Requires Improvement’
by Ofsted. The present school opened in 2015.
This school is a member of
Mercia Learning Trust
. (Other schools in this trust include
Nether Edge Primary School
and
Totley Primary School
.)
Particular strengths include
Progress
and
Disadvantaged pupils
. Relative weaknesses include
Attendance
and
Environment
.

Progress:
Excellent. Progress in maths is above average, in reading it is excellent and in writing it is excellent. (This takes into account pupils' prior performance. For actual grades, see Attainment.)
Disadvantaged pupils:
Excellent. Progress in maths is above average. Progress in reading is excellent. Progress in writing is excellent.
Admissions:
About average. The occupancy rate and offer rate are both very high.
Attainment:
Below average. Maths attainment is below average, reading is below average and GPS (grammar, punctuation and spelling) is about average. (This doesn't take into account pupils' prior performance. For that, see Progress.)
Environment:
Below average. Air pollution and traffic accidents are quite low, while crime is very high.
Finances:
Poor. However, the school budget has been roughly in balance
Representation:
Out of balance. The socio-economic mix is out of balance with the local community, while ethnic representation is slightly out of balance with the local community.
Show details
Attendance:
Poor. Pupil absence rates and the incidence of persistent absence are both very high.
